RF Remote vs Bluetooth App: The Operational Difference Most Guides Skip

RF (radio frequency) remotes operate on a fixed frequency band and do not require a paired device. You press a button, the signal travels. The practical range is up to 10 metres in open air, but walls, human bodies, and electronic interference reduce this to 3–8 metres in most real indoor environments.

Bluetooth app models work differently. The vibrator pairs to your phone via Bluetooth, then the app routes commands through the internet. This means the person controlling the toy can be in a different country, provided both devices have internet access. The latency is typically 0.5–2 seconds depending on connection quality — noticeable but not a dealbreaker for most use cases.

The failure mode of each type is distinct:

  • RF remotes fail when there's signal interference or distance exceeds range. The toy stops responding; there's no graceful fallback.
  • App models fail when internet drops. Svakom's FeelConnect app continues local Bluetooth control if the remote user loses connection, which is a useful safety net.

If you're buying for a single partner in the same room, an RF remote is simpler and more reliable. If you're buying for long-distance use, app-only is the correct choice — an RF remote is functionally useless at 500km.

What Battery Life Actually Means in Continuous Use

Battery specifications from manufacturers are measured at the lowest vibration setting. Real-world continuous use at mid-to-high intensity typically runs 40–60% of the stated maximum.

The Svakom Ella Neo is rated at approximately 2 hours at minimum setting. Under real conditions:

  • 80–120 min at lowest setting
  • 55–75 min at medium intensity
  • 40–55 min at maximum intensity

For a single session of 20–40 minutes, any rechargeable model in this category is adequate. The Nu Sensuelle Remote Bullet uses replaceable LR44 batteries — no charging required between uses, which is useful for travel, but you'll want to keep spares on hand for extended play.

Magnetic USB charging (Satisfyer Sexy Secret) and standard USB charging (Svakom Ella Neo) typically reach full charge in 60–90 minutes. Avoid storing any lithium-cell model fully discharged for periods longer than 4 weeks — it degrades battery capacity faster than partial-charge storage.


Svakom Ella Neo vs Satisfyer Sexy Secret: Which App-Controlled Option to Buy

These are the two most popular app-controlled options stocked in Australia under $110 AUD, and they serve different use cases.

Svakom Ella Neo ($104.95) is a standalone bullet. It sits externally or can be held in place during partnered sex. The FeelConnect 3.0 app includes a pattern editor, sync-to-music mode, interactive 2D video sync, and long-distance partner control. Silicone body, waterproof, approximately 2-hour battery life. It is not a wearable — you need a hand or partner to position it.

Satisfyer Sexy Secret ($69.95) is wearable. It sits inside a panty pocket against the clitoris and is controlled via the Satisfyer Connect app. Dual independently controllable motors, IPX7 waterproof, magnetic USB charging. The design means hands-free wear during movement. The main fit variable is underwear style: tight briefs or hipster-cut hold the toy securely; looser styles cause it to shift. The Satisfyer Connect app's free-vibration draw feature — trace patterns on the screen for custom vibration — is genuinely different from standard button-cycling.

If discretion and hands-free wear are the priority: Satisfyer Sexy Secret.
If pure vibration intensity and partner-to-partner app control matter more: Svakom Ella Neo.

When a Remote Bullet Vibrator Is the Wrong Purchase

If you want powerful internal stimulation: Bullet vibrators are designed for external, surface stimulation. The motors are small; internal vibration through body tissue is significantly dampened. A wand or rabbit vibrator delivers meaningfully stronger internal sensation.

If you want long-distance use with a partner in a different timezone: App latency of 1–2 seconds is fine for real-time play. It is frustrating for async or scheduled sessions where one partner is waiting — the interaction requires live participation from both parties.

If you have sensitive skin or silicone concerns: The Svakom Ella Neo, Svakom Elva, and Satisfyer Sexy Secret all use body-safe silicone exteriors. The Nu Sensuelle Remote Bullet and iJoy Panties bullet are ABS plastic — phthalate-free and CE-approved, but not silicone. Check the material specification before purchasing if this matters to you.

If you rely on strong grip or pressure: Remote bullet vibrators are small. They do not apply pressure the way a wand head does. If previous vibrators felt "not strong enough," a remote bullet is unlikely to be the solution — consider a wand vibrator instead.

Frequently Asked Questions

How far does a remote bullet vibrator work?

RF remote models (iJoy Panties, Svakom Elva, Nu Sensuelle): up to 10 metres in open air, typically 3–8 metres in real indoor environments due to walls and interference. App-controlled models (Svakom Ella Neo, Satisfyer Sexy Secret): unlimited distance provided both devices have internet access.

Can I use a remote bullet vibrator in public?

Yes. Panty-style wearable models (Satisfyer Sexy Secret, iJoy Panties) are designed for public wear. App-controlled versions are the most discreet because the control interface is a phone screen. RF remote models require holding a physical remote, which is more visible.

What is the difference between a bullet vibrator and a remote bullet vibrator?

The vibrator unit is functionally identical. The remote control function adds either an RF receiver (physical remote) or a Bluetooth chip (app control). Remote control does not increase vibration strength — it changes who controls the settings and from where.

Do app-controlled vibrators require WiFi?

No. Bluetooth app control works without WiFi when both devices are within Bluetooth range (approximately 8–10 metres direct). Long-distance control requires mobile data or WiFi on both the toy's paired phone and the controlling device.
